Composition of Essential Oil of Bidens cernua L., Asteraceae from Serbia

Chalchat, Jean-Claude; Petrović, Silvana; Maksimović, Zoran; Gorunović, Momčilo

AB  - Chemical composition of the essential oil isolated by hydrodistillation from the aerial blooming parts of Bidens cernua was analyzed. By GC and GC/MS analysis, 16 components were identified (70.1% of the total oil). The plant material yielded 0.5% (v/w) of gold-yellowish liquid with intensive, unpleasant and heavy scent. The principal compound was identified 1-phenylhepta-1,3,5-triyne (57.1%), followed by sesquiterpenes caryophyllene oxide, humulene-1,2-epoxide and alpha-selinene (3.0%, 3.1%, and 1.1% respectively), as well as (E,E)-1,3,11-tridecatriene-5,7,9-triyne (1.8%).

Composition of Essential Oils of Flowers, Leaves, Stems and Rhizome of Peucedanum officinale L. (Apiaceae)

AB  - The results of the chemical investigations of the essential oils from the flowers, leaves, sterns and rhizome of Peucedanum officinale are presented. The essential oil contents were 1.21% (v/w) in flowers, 0.64% (v/w) in leaves, 0.08% (v/w) in stems and 0.24% (v/w) in rhizome. By CC and GC/MS analysis, in all four oils the total of 132 compounds; was identified: 53 constituents (93.4% of total amount) in the oil obtained from the flowers, 70 (94.3% of total amount) in the oil from the leaves, 78 (87.8% of total amount) in the oil from the sterns and 67 (95.9% of total amount) in the oil from rhizome. in all oils investigated, monoterpenes were the dominant class of constituents (73.9-83.7%), with hydrocarbons (65.6-81.6%) as the most abundant representatives. Limonene, alpha-pinene and sabinene were identified as the most important constituents in common for all flour oils. In the oil from the flowers, leaves and sterns, beta-pinene and myrcene were also abundant. However, the flower oil differed from the others by a significant quantity of alpha-phellandrene.

AB  - The aerial parts of the wild plant Nepeta nuda L. collected in Serbia and the Durmitor region contained respectively 0.67–0.70% and 0.4% oil. Each oil was analyzed by GC and GC/MS. The main constituent was 1,8-cineole; (42.8–63.8%), with the higher level found in the oil of plants harvested in full flower. Other major constituents included germacrene D (1.8–15.0%), β-caryophyllene (3.6–6.9%) and α-terpineol (6.9–7.0%).
